More about the event and the Handshake Foundation:
The Handshake Foundation, created by retired DSW CFO Doug Probst will host its inaugural fundraiser this Thursday at Vue. Named "The Huddle," the event will feature nationally recognized author and speaker Dr. Kevin Elko, who has been a consultant to seven BCS National Championship football teams, five NFL teams as well as numerous corporations including Morgan Stanley and Abbott Labs. The Huddle will also feature self-introductions by the 2014 Handshake Foundation student-athletes.
The sponsors for the event are Big Lots, Deloitte, DSW and Summerfield Advertising.
Founded in 2011, the Handshake Foundation is a combination mentorship and scholarship program that seeks to partner high school athletes with local business leaders. The program's first year, students from three high schools took part (Gahanna Lincoln, Reynoldsburg and Whitehall Yearling). In 2013 that number grew to eight and in 2014, 16 area high schools are currently participating in the program.
The genesis of The Handshake Foundation was an informal conversation between Probst and a professional baseball scout at a youth baseball game. When asked about what he looked for in prospects, the scout Joe Morlan, Sr. said "If he doesn't give me a firm handshake and look me in the eye, I don't even go to the game."
